Do I need an editorial calendar?

Do I need an editorial calendar?

 Do I need an editorial calendar?

Some businesses swear by them, other not so much. How important an editorial calendar is depends on your individual strategy. 

However, even if you don’t maintain a full-blown, detailed editorial calendar, you should at least plan out your content a month in advance, noting any holidays or promotion dates you want to mark with special content.

What is content marketing exactly?

  What is content marketing exactly?   Content marketing turns traditional marketing on its head. Instead of focusing on a company and its products or services, it focuses on the consumer’s needs first.  The goal of a properly planned content marketing campaign or strategy is to provide valuable, genuinely helpful information to consumers for free, in order to create a relationship with them based on trust, which eventually leads them to make a purchase. How much historical data will I get from Google Analytics?

  How much historical data will I get from Google Analytics? We download 2 years of historical data per default from the day you connect your Google Analytics data source. If, however, your GA view was created after that or you have a shorter data retention that will set how far back we go.
